Job Details
The Assistant Scientist promotes quality, safety and health, by ensuring clean work area, and adherence to procedures and safety culture.Performs laboratory analysis of samples, using aseptic technique, following established procedures and in full compliance with official compendial, health authority regulations, and established BMS policies. Conductsqualification of methods and/or other laboratory studies, according to scientific protocols. Maintains accurate records of work performed and documents results, according to Good Documentation Practices and established procedures as well as perform data entry into LIMS. Assist with review of worksheets and laboratory data as assigned. Assists in the investigation of OOS results in areas of assigned responsibility. Operates and maintains laboratory instruments, while ensuring the reliability of instrumentation through proper maintenance, with ability to troubleshoot minor issues. Analyzes, evaluates, and interprets data, notifying clients of results, and assisting to resolve issues, if applicable. Identifies opportunities for workflow and procedural improvements.The Assistant Scientist willparticipate and lead continuous improvement using lean principles to assist with streamlining and making the laboratory efficient.

Physical Demands:
This position is a lab-based position which requires appropriate levels of personal protective equipment (PPE). This role will require contact with biohazardous materials such as live cell cultures and other hazardous chemicals including methotrexate, acids, and caustics. Powdered materials and high temperature liquids and solids are also handled. Frequent repeated motions such as pipetting, lifting, bending, twisting, squatting, crouching, kneeling, climbing on step-stools, and reaching is required. This role also requires frequent unassisted lifting (not to exceed 50 lbs). Repetitive use of arms/hands/wrists and grasping is also required. Depending on the work demands, office-based work requires sitting.
Work Environment:
This position is based indoors and you will primarily be working with others, but also independently and alone at times. This position is a team-based position that willrequire shift work, weekends, and holidays.
